A leading healthcare provider in Glasgow is seeking a dynamic individual to lead a primary care team within Prison Health Care. The candidate will manage service delivery at HMP Greenock and should demonstrate operational and strategic skills. Essential qualifications include 1st Level Registered Nurse certification and V300 practitioner registration. The role requires significant experience in healthcare, especially dealing with complex patient needs. Candidates must possess strong leadership and communication skills in a challenging environment.
NHS Greater Glasgow and Clyde is one of the largest healthcare systems in the UK employing around 40,000 staff in a wide range of clinical and non‑clinical professions and job roles. We deliver acute hospital, primary, community and mental health care services to a population of over 1.15 million and a wider population of 2.2 million when our regional and national services are included.
An exciting opportunity has arisen for a dynamic individual to lead and develop a primary care team within Prison Health Care at HMP Greenock. The role will share the overall management for service delivery within HMP Greenock and report directly to the Service Manager for Prison Health Care.
The successful candidate should be able to demonstrate an ability to work at both an operational and strategic level to support development for this team.
